    You need to watch the film Cradle Will Rock if that's what you think.

    You should watch it anyway because it's a great movie, but it's also based on a true story about people getting government funding and using it to put on a socialist musical, which made the government freak out and shut the show down. That is what would stifle art- not artists being loyal, artists not being allowed to dissent.
